Biography

R. S. White, MA (Adelaide), D.Phil (Oxford), FAHA, is an Emeritus Professor and Senior Honorary Research Fellow at the University of Western Australia. He served as the Head of the English Department from 1989 to 1992 and again from 1995 to 1997. White is recognized for his contributions to Australian humanities and has been a Fellow of the Australian Humanities Academy. He has held significant positions, including Chief Coordinator at the ARC Centre of Excellence for the History of Emotions. His extensive research work includes projects such as 'Romantic Pacifism' and publications like 'Shakespeare Against War' and 'Keats's Anatomy of Melancholy.' He has also served as a visiting research fellow at notable institutions including Balliol College, Oxford, and the University of Newcastle upon Tyne, and has participated in various prestigious research fellowships. His teaching and research interests cover Shakespeare, early modern literature, romantic literature, and emotions in literature, reflecting his diverse expertise in cultural studies and human rights literature.
